These days, crime has become an increasing concern in the society. Most offenders commit felony, even after being punished by the law. This essay will discuss why this trend occurs and put forward several solutions, how to fight this issue. Prisoners feel a sense of resentment. They believe what they have done is justified and the court has falsely accused them for their deed. For instance, a thief believes that, he has only stolen something to feed his family or to live a better life. Although, his intentions weren't wrong, choosing to steal is definitely not the right method. This thinking nurtures the wrong idea. Another factor linked to the first is that, certain people are mentally disturbed and have psychosocial problems. To illustrate this, few criminals cannot differentiate the right from wrong and make bad decisions. This is not something a punishment could rectify. Counselling is the key to this problem. Every jail should have counsellors that can guide the prisoners to live in the righteous way. For example, a counsellor can demonstrate better ways to make a livelihood rather than resorting to theft. This in turn would help the person to work hard and live an honest life. Whereas, others with mental issues can be referred to a psychiatrist. They could receive some sort of therapy to keep themselves in a sane state of mind. In conclusion, criminals often tend to repeat their mistakes even after being penalized. This may be due to lack of guidance during their time in jail or due to mental health issues. Therefore, it is necessary to have an advisor to help with their troubles.
